Colombia: July 15, 2005

Archives

The government offensive against the 30,000 or so organized rebels in the country has had dramatic effects this year. While some 300 soldiers have been killed so far this year, thousands of rebels have died or, more importantly, left the rebel ranks. This was done largely by going after rebels camps, and over 700 of these camps have been captured and destroyed. Losing your living space has been bad for rebel morale. The troops have also seized over 500 rebel vehicles and much other property besides.
